Jackman is now expected to face a judge and jury on March 14. The St Philip resident is alleged to have stolen $678,414.75 from HEJ Limited between June 23, 2006 and March 5, 2007. Jackman is also accused of engaging in money laundering by directly conducting transactions involving the alleged stolen money between June 23, 2006, and October 18, 2011. He has pleaded not guilty to the charges. The trial is set before Justice Randall Worrell in the No. 2 Supreme Court. He is being represented by attorney-at-law Mohia Maโat and Senior Crown Counsel Olivia Davis is the prosecutor.
